How they compare
Zambia currently reports 0.2% against 0.2% in Bangladesh, a difference of 0.0%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 14 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Zambia ahead.
Bangladesh ranks 123rd and Zambia ranks 122nd of 133 countries.
Zambia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bangladesh | Zambia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.3% | 2.7% | 2.4% | Zambia |
| 2010s | 0.3% | 2.4% | 2.1% | Zambia |
| 2020s | 0.2% | 0.2% | 0.0% | Zambia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
